Nick Khan‘s WWE Role: From Usher to president,a WrestleMania Journey
Nick Khan’s ascent to WWE President and board member of TKO Group Holdings marks a remarkable career trajectory. But did you know his involvement with WWE dates back to 1993 when he worked as an usher at WrestleMania 9 in Las Vegas? Today, Khan collaborates closely with Paul “Triple H” Levesque, WWE’s Chief Content Officer, on key business and creative decisions, navigating the complexities of the wrestling entertainment giant [1].

From Usher to executive: Khan’s WrestleMania Connection
in the lead-up to WrestleMania 41, Triple H revealed Khan’s early role with WWE: an usher at Caesar’s Palace during WrestleMania 9 in 1993. This revelation came during the release of a documentary featuring previously unreleased backstage footage from WWE’s first attempt to bring its premier event to Las Vegas. The footage highlights Khan’s long-standing, albeit initially behind-the-scenes, connection to the wrestling world.

The Evolution of WWE Leadership
WWE has seen significant changes in its leadership structure over the years. From the McMahon family’s long-standing control to the integration of new executives like Nick Khan, the company continues to adapt to the evolving landscape of sports entertainment. The merger with UFC under TKO Group Holdings represents a new chapter in WWE’s history,requiring strategic leadership to navigate the complexities of a larger,more diverse organization.
